Amritsar is a sacred city built around the Golden Temple, threaded with old bazaars, metalwork, Phulkari, and a devotional memory that runs through every lane. In the craft archive of Punjab, it holds Phulkari embroidery, metal utensils, and bazaar textiles — the city's hands move between devotion and trade.

The Landscape

अमृतसर

The setting shapes the craft. Here that means the temple pool, the narrow old lanes, the market streets, and a sacred geometry that organises the whole walled city around water and reflection.

Geography is never neutral in a craft city. The land decides what materials arrive, what light falls on the worktable, and what a maker reaches for first.
